Cedar Hills Hospital is a 98-bed, freestanding psychiatric hospital and outpatient center specializing in mental health and substance use disorder treatment. Cedar Hills Hospital provides a wide range of services and programs that offer evidence-based treatment proven to have positive outcomes for our patients. Our inpatient and outpatient services offer supportive and compassionate care through specialty programs tailored to meet the needs of our patients.

Cedar Hills Hospital currently has an opening for a full time Recreation Therapist who is responsible for planning and implementing activity services for assigned programs, which involves defining and implementing treatment goals as a member of the interdisciplinary treatment team and providing continuous patient care, observation, interaction, and role modeling to patients.

Qualifications

Education: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university in occupational, art, music, or recreational therapy, social work or related therapeutic discipline, or a Master's degree in art therapy, preferred.

Experience: One (1) year of related experience, with knowledge of psychiatric patient care techniques with understanding of mental illness, preferred.

Licensure: Oregon License, accreditation or board certification.

Additional Requirements: Successful completion of CPR Certification, Crisis Management and Service Excellence training must occur within 90 days of employment and prior to assisting in any restraining procedures. May be required to work occasional overtime and flexible hours.
